The Minnesota Historical Society preserves Minnesota's past, shares our state's stories and connects people with history in meaningful ways. Using the power of history to transform lives, the Minnesota Historical Society is a nonprofit educational and cultural institution established in 1849. The society preserves our past, shares our state's stories, and connects people with history. It does this through extensive libraries and collections, innovative exhibits, educational programs, historic sites throughout the state and book publishing through the MNHS Press.
